Tuning the ligament/channel size of nanoporous copper by temperature control†
Abstract
Nanoporous Cu powders have been fabricated through mechanical alloying and subsequent dealloying. The ligament/channel size of as small as 21.3 ± 2.7 nm has been obtained by dealloying as-milled Al–Cu powders in a NaOH solution at room temperature, and can be tuned by changing the dealloying temperature.
